Citigroup agrees to support Mortgage Modifications
January 08, 2009
Topic: Bankruptcy
Citigroup has agreed to back the Democrats' plan for modifying existing mortgages through a Chapter 13 plan. Again, currently first mortgages cannot be modified, even if the exisiting mortgage more than the home itself is worth. Under this plan, the mortgages could be modified as second mortgages or vehicle loans can be. There are exceptions to the rules and the modification process is lengthy. However, the relief can be tremendous.
